Gifting Silver - Always a great gift.

There is no greater joy in this world than gifting a stacker some silver! Through conversations with one of my clients I discovered that he was a stacker.

Every year he purchases the book of coins and tries to get as many of the latest coins as he can.

When I discovered he was a stacker there were two pieces I knew I had to get in his possession.

  1. 2017 Steem Silver Round.
  2. Boy Scout Centennial Silver Dollar

The Steem Silver Round was an obvious choice to gift him as it was something that is so meaningful to me!

Through our conversations I came to realize that he was a scout leader. The second I heard this I knew he would appreciate the Boy Scout round.

I came about these rounds in an interesting way. The LCS received a shipment one day and I picked up all they had at spot. I didn’t think I would get much more for them than spot if I were to ever sell them. I posted an ad online, maybe craigslist, and this troop leader responded and wanted to purchase all that I had! It was around 150-200 rounds total, some were proofs and some were BU. We decided on a price that netted me an extra 50 ounces of silver so it was a no-brainer for me and the guy got silver rounds for his whole crew.

I cannot wait to see the smile on his face tomorrow when I give the silver rounds to him!
